Overview of Low Carbon Steel Coils and Strips

Low carbon steel coils and strips are essential materials in various industries. Their low carbon content, usually below 0.3%, gives them excellent ductility and weldability. This makes them ideal for applications like automotive manufacturing and construction. The malleability of these materials allows for easy forming into desired shapes. They can be produced in various thicknesses and widths, catering to different requirements.

The versatility of low carbon steel makes it a preferred choice for many buyers. These products can be easily coated for additional protection against corrosion. Furthermore, they are often used in producing pipes, tanks, and other structural elements. The demand remains steady due to their cost-effectiveness and efficiency.

Key Properties and Benefits of Low Carbon Steel

Low carbon steel coils and strips play a crucial role in various industries due to their favorable properties. These materials contain carbon levels typically below 0.25%, making them malleable and ductile. This unique composition allows for easy fabrication and welding, essential in automotive and construction sectors. According to the World Steel Association, low carbon steel accounts for over 50% of global steel production, highlighting its significance.

One of the primary benefits of low carbon steel is its excellent formability. This property enables manufacturers to create complex shapes and designs without compromising structural integrity. Additionally, it offers good tensile strength, ensuring durability. The American Iron and Steel Institute notes that low carbon steels maintain a good balance between strength and workability, essential for producing high-performance components.

Low carbon steel also exhibits superior corrosion resistance when properly treated. Many manufacturers utilize coatings to enhance this property further. Applications of Low Carbon Steel Coils in Various Industries

Low carbon steel coils play a vital role in various industries. Their flexibility and durability make them an ideal choice for manufacturing and construction. In automotive production, these coils are used for body panels and frames. This application requires materials that can withstand impact while remaining lightweight.

In the construction sector, low carbon steel coils are essential for creating structural components. They are often used in beams and reinforcements. This ensures buildings maintain structural integrity under various loads. Additionally, low carbon steel is resistant to rust, aiding in long-term performance.
